Font Size Best Practices for Mobile App Design

When it comes to mobile app design, the choice of font size plays a crucial role in determining the overall user experience. This article will delve into the best practices for selecting font sizes, ensuring readability, accessibility, and aesthetics for users across various devices. With the growing importance of mobile-first design, it's essential to understand how different font sizes can impact user engagement, usability, and the overall success of an app.

Understanding the Importance of Font Size

Font size in mobile app design is more than just a stylistic choice—it's a fundamental aspect of usability. A well-chosen font size ensures that users can read content comfortably without straining their eyes, which directly affects how long they stay engaged with the app. If the text is too small, it can lead to frustration and abandonment, while excessively large text might disrupt the overall design balance.

General Guidelines for Font Size in Mobile Apps

  1. Minimum Font Size: For body text, a minimum size of 16px is recommended. This size is considered a safe choice for readability on most screens without zooming.

  2. Headings and Subheadings: Headings should be larger than body text to create a clear hierarchy. Common sizes for headings are 20-24px, while subheadings might range from 18-20px.

  3. Accessibility Considerations: Ensure that the text is legible for users with visual impairments. This might involve using slightly larger font sizes or allowing users to adjust text size within the app settings.

  4. Line Height and Spacing: Proper line height (at least 1.2 to 1.5 times the font size) and adequate spacing between text elements can significantly enhance readability.

Adapting Font Sizes for Different Devices

Mobile devices come in various sizes, from small smartphones to large tablets. It's essential to design responsive typography that adapts to different screen sizes and resolutions.

  1. Responsive Typography: Use relative units like "em" or "rem" instead of fixed sizes like "px" to ensure text scales appropriately across devices.

  2. Viewport-Based Scaling: Consider using media queries to adjust font sizes based on the device's viewport dimensions. For instance, smaller screens might require slightly larger text to maintain readability.

Case Studies: Successful Mobile Apps

  • Instagram: Instagram uses a simple and clean font with a base size of 16px for body text, ensuring readability even on smaller screens. Headings are bold and slightly larger, creating a clear visual hierarchy.

  • Medium: Medium, a platform for reading and writing articles, prioritizes readability with a base font size of 18px for body text and larger sizes for headings. The spacing and line height are meticulously crafted to enhance the reading experience.

Font Size in Different UI Elements

  1. Buttons: Button text should be large enough to tap easily, usually around 14-16px. The text should be bold to differentiate it from other elements.

  2. Navigation Bars: Text in navigation bars should be clear and concise, typically around 14-16px, ensuring it’s legible without taking up too much space.

  3. Tooltips and Labels: These elements often require smaller font sizes, but they should still be readable—usually around 12-14px.

Best Practices for Testing Font Sizes

  • User Testing: Conduct user testing with real users on different devices to determine the most appropriate font sizes for your target audience.

  • A/B Testing: Experiment with different font sizes to see which ones lead to better engagement and retention.

Conclusion

Selecting the right font size in mobile app design is a critical factor that can significantly influence user satisfaction and overall app success. By adhering to best practices and considering the diverse needs of your users, you can create an app that is both visually appealing and highly usable.

Popular Comments
    No Comments Yet
Comment

0